ASTM D6439 is the ASTM standard that addresses cleaning, flushing, and purification of steam, gas, and hydroelectric turbine lubrication systems. It is relevant when maintaining lubrication circuits where contamination control can affect equipment reliability and operating performance. By focusing on system cleanliness and fluid condition, this technical document supports more consistent maintenance practices and helps users evaluate whether a lubrication system has been properly prepared for service or return to service.

ASTM D6439 standard overview

ASTM D6439 provides a guide for cleaning, flushing, and purification activities applied to turbine lubrication systems used with steam, gas, and hydroelectric equipment. The standard’s main value is to offer a structured technical reference for handling lubrication-system contamination and restoring acceptable cleanliness conditions. As an ASTM standard, it is useful for planning maintenance work, supporting engineering decisions, and aligning cleaning procedures with a recognized industry document. ASTM D6439 is typically used as a basis for consistent system preparation rather than as a product specification.

Where is ASTM D6439 used?

This standard is commonly used in turbine maintenance environments where lubrication systems must be cleaned, flushed, or purified before startup, after service work, or during restoration activities. It applies to systems associated with steam turbines, gas turbines, and hydroelectric turbines, especially where oil cleanliness and fluid integrity matter. ASTM D6439 is often referenced by maintenance teams, engineering personnel, and contractors responsible for preparing lubrication systems and verifying that the process follows a recognized guide.
